Analysis

Tunisia recorded 39.6% for share of children with diarrhea receiving oral rehydration salts in 2018.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 27.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of children with diarrhea receiving oral rehydration salts in Tunisia peaked at 65.1% in 2012 and was at its lowest, 27.0%, in 1986.

Tunisia ranks 56th of 96 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
